Video: Dam overflows, floods highway, and becomes a festive spot with sound car in the interior of PI

Residents are celebrating on a flooded highway in Piauí after a dam overflowed, with videos showing them enjoying the water without any formal safety measures.

A recent incident in Piauí, Brazil, has gone viral as a video shows residents celebrating on the flooded PI-243 highway between Belém do Piauí and Padre Marcos after a nearby dam overflowed. The footage depicts people enjoying drinks and playing in the water, with children participating in the festivities. The lack of official safety measures, such as support from the Fire Department, raises concerns about the potential dangers involved in such celebrations.

The flooded area of the highway has been submerged for days due to excess rainwater, a common occurrence during Brazil's rainy season. The locals are used to dealing with water accumulation in their region, which often leads to playful interactions with the environment. The overflow has created a temporary oasis that draws in community members looking for amusement, although it presents significant risks due to the obstruction of the roadway.

Local authorities, including the Police Military, have been notified concerning the obstruction created by the flooding. This incident has received attention partly because of its partnership with the local mayor, Jônathas Noronha, suggesting a relationship between the local government and the community's recreational activities, despite the lack of safety protocol in such a potentially hazardous environment.
